Choosing The Right Puppy copyright: A Comparison

Finding the perfect canine copyright can feel overwhelming with so many choices available. Including traditional hard-sided crates to comfortable flexible bags and even stylish backpacks, each kind offers distinct pros and cons. Hard-sided carriers generally provide superior protection and are perfect for travel, while soft-sided carriers are lighter to transport and often fold for easy storage. Backpack carriers, increasingly popular, allow for hands-free movement but have weight limitations. Ultimately, the right choice depends on your canine's dimensions, your travel style, and your personal preferences. Consider these elements meticulously before coming to a decision.

Determining the Perfect Pet copyright Size Chart

Finding the appropriate capacity pet copyright can feel overwhelming, but it’s essential for your furry friend's comfort and safety. Generally, your pet should be able to stand comfortably, move around, and recline down naturally inside the crate. Measure your pet's pet carrier height from the tip of their ears to their toes when they are in a upright position. Also, measure their extent from their face to the base of their rear. As a general principle, add approximately 2-3 inches to each measurement to ensure enough room. Consider breeds that grow, as a kitten's copyright needs will evolve as they grow. Remember, a larger crate is often more advantageous than one that's too small.
